All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/ ________________________________________________ AGNES BEAL Mrs. Agnes Beal, aged 68, wife of George Beal, died Monday morning at her home near St. Paul (Wilhelm) Church, following prolonged illness from paralysis. Surviving are her husband and these children: William, of St. Paul; Charles and John A., both of Lewistown; James E., of Akron, O.; Roy E., of Fearer, Md.; Mrs. Mollie Rhoads and Mrs. R. A. Staub, both of St. Paul; Mrs. Edith Bowser, of Meyersdale; Mrs. Hattie Shawley and Mrs. Nellie Livengood, both of Grantsville, Md. Due to the illness of the pastor of St. Paul's Church, Rev. M. A. Kieffer, Rev. B. A. Black, pastor of Amity Reformed Church, conducted the funeral services, Wednesday morning at 10 o'clock. Undertaker J. L. Tressler had charge of the funeral arrangements. Meyersdale Republican, September 17, 1931
